From 2001-2003, the LS430 had the same body style, so that would be pointless. I am sure you meant 02 LS to 04-06 LS conversion. In that case, you'll need everything to do it, it's not a simple conversion. You'll need hood, fenders, headlights, front bumper, rear bumper, trunk, tail lights, etc. Freddie from AutoFashion did it and he said it was a pita. Just get a nice bodykit, that's a much much cheaper route imo.
